Vanessa Gandarillas is a skilled professional with extensive experience in environmental consultancy and project management, currently serving as Project Associate for Latin America and The Caribbean at Sanitation and Water for All since September 2020. Prior to this role, Vanessa held positions as a Graduate Research Fellow at Universität Bonn and as an environmental technician and consultant at several organizations including GIC SRL and Total. Vanessa's academic background includes a PhD in Natural Sciences from The University of Bonn, an MSc in Water Quality Management from Delft University of Technology, and a Bachelor's degree in Environmental Engineering from Universidad Catolica Boliviana.

Sanitation and Water for All
SWA is a global partnership of over 400 country governments, private sector and civil society organizations, external support agencies, research and learning institutions and other development partners working together to catalyse political leadership and action, improve accountability and use scarce resources more effectively. Partners work towards a common vision of sanitation, hygiene and water for all, always and everywhere.
